Sap Treasury Consultant salary in Luxembourg

Average Yearly Salary of Sap Treasury Consultant in Luxembourg is approximately 177,339 EUR (177,643 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Sap Treasury Consultant do?

occupation personasA SAP Treasury Consultant is responsible for implementing and optimizing the SAP Treasury and Risk Management (TRM) module for organizations. They work closely with clients to understand their financial requirements, design solutions, configure the system, and provide ongoing support. These consultants are experts in treasury management processes, including cash and liquidity management, risk management, debt and investment management, and financial accounting. The role involves analyzing client's current treasury operations, identifying areas for improvement, and developing strategies to streamline processes. They coll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ate TRM with other SAP modules such as finance, accounting, and supply chain management. SAP Treasury Consultants also provide training to end-users and ensure smooth system implementation.

Skills: SAP Treasury, Treasury Management, Risk Management, Financial Accounting, Cash Management, Liquidity Management
